Transaction 8352dccd7283e3683d00118751a279943a6803c6489a36f9bf8c2c655489964e
1 Input
1 Output
-
8352dccd7283e3683d00118751a279943a6803c6489a36f9bf8c2c655489964e:0
- value
- 42980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4ea9e6923e4008e2f4d6523af0d343a8b77c809 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MsQ8LXvEmZU5aKKoMJHj1GYVUXKq74KZ3